Visual SourceSafe 使用教程:从安装到版本管理

需积分: 9 2 下载量 75 浏览量 更新于2024-08-16 收藏 2.71MB PPT 举报
"SourceSafe 使用教程 - 客户端安装与应用" SourceSafe 是一款由Microsoft收购的版本控制管理工具,通常称为Visual SourceSafe (VSS)。它主要用于代码管理、软件版本控制、并行开发以及配置管理,尤其适用于团队协作环境。通过将不同类型的文件存储在内部数据库中,SourceSafe 提供了文件共享、版本追踪和历史记录等功能,使得团队成员可以协同工作并确保文件的一致性和完整性。 **为什么要使用SourceSafe** 1. **代码管理**:SourceSafe 可以帮助管理和跟踪代码的更改,确保代码的质量和可追溯性。 2. **软件的版本管理**:它记录文件的不同版本,允许用户回滚到旧版本,便于问题排查和修复。 3. **并行开发**:允许多个开发者同时处理同一项目,避免了文件冲突。 4. **有效沟通**:通过版本控制,开发者可以了解其他团队成员的修改,促进了团队间的沟通。 5. **配置管理**:SourceSafe 提供了项目配置的管理,确保在开发过程中不同环境下的配置一致性。 **概述** SourceSafe 的工程组织方式类似于操作系统的目录结构,但提供了额外的版本控制、历史记录和文件合并等高级功能。虽然VSS不是Microsoft原创的产品,因此在某些方面可能不符合Windows应用程序的标准,但它依然被广泛用于小型到中型的项目中。 **术语词汇** - **项目**:在VSS中的文件集合,可以进行添加、删除、编辑和共享。 - **版本号**:VSS自动维护的内部数字,表示文件或项目的版本变化,是递增的整数。 - **标签**:用户自定义的字符串,标识特定版本,方便查找和引用。 - **日期/时间戳**:记录文件的修改时间或签入时间,支持12小时和24小时格式。 - **版本跟踪**:保存和追踪文件的历史版本,便于bug追踪或其他需求。 **SourceSafe的安装** SourceSafe 的安装分为两个主要部分:**服务端安装** 和 **客户端安装**。 1. **VSS6.0服务器的安装**:首先需要在服务器上安装SourceSafe服务器,这将创建数据库并提供团队成员访问的入口。 2. **VSS6.0客户端的安装**:接着,团队成员在各自的开发机器上安装客户端,通过连接到服务器来访问和管理项目文件。 安装完成后,用户可以开始学习如何使用SourceSafe的基本操作,如添加文件、签出(Checkout)、签入(Checkin)、查看历史记录、创建标签、分支与合并等。此外,教程还可能涵盖高级操作,如解决冲突、备份和恢复数据库等,以确保团队高效地利用SourceSafe进行软件开发。